From 4db713720e4a37378e4e7d0b2288c6bad6c33f37 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Devon Fulcher <24593113+DevonFulcher@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Wed, 13 May 2026 08:55:56 -0500 Subject: [PATCH] test(lsp): silence asyncio DeprecationWarning in sync tests Bind a fresh event loop in the four `TestMessageHandling` tests that build futures synchronously, and use `loop.create_future()` instead of bare `asyncio.Future()`. Without this, pytest emits a `DeprecationWarning: There is no current event loop` and the tests will eventually fail outright on Python versions that drop implicit loop creation.
